CC -!- CATALYTIC ACTIVITY: AN ORTHOPHOSPHORIC MONOESTER + H(2)O = AN CC ALCOHOL + ORTHOPHOSPHATE (AT A HIGH PH OPTIMUM). CC -!- SUBUNIT: HOMODIMER. CC -!- SUBCELLULAR LOCATION: ATTACHED TO THE MEMBRANE BY A GPI-ANCHOR. CC -!- POLYMORPHISM: PLACENTAL ALP IS HIGHLY POLYMORPHIC, THERE ARE AT CC LEAST THREE COMMON ALLELES. CC -!- IN MOST MAMMALS THERE ARE FOUR DIFFERENT ISOZYMES: PLACENTAL, CC PLACENTAL-LIKE, INTESTINAL AND TISSUE NON-SPECIFIC (LIVER/BONE/ CC KIDNEY). CC -!- SIMILARITY: STRONG TO ALL OTHER MAMMALIAN AP, AND TO BACTERIAL CC AND YEAST AP. DR EMBL; M14170; G178470; -. DR PIR; B24318; B24318. DR HSSP; P00634; 1ALK. DR MIM; 171800; -.
